How they compare
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) currently reports 102.77 billion current USD against 20.95 billion current USD in Brazil, a difference of 81.82 billion current USD.
That makes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income)'s figure about 4.9 times Brazil's.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1993 it was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) ahead.
Brazil ranks 22nd and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) ranks 23rd of 168 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Brazil averaged higher in 2 and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Brazil |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 12.03 billion current USD | 9.86 billion current USD | 2.17 billion current USD | Brazil |
| 2000s | 15.07 billion current USD | 18.06 billion current USD | 2.99 billion current USD |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) |
| 2010s | 30.26 billion current USD | 29.99 billion current USD | 278.67 million current USD | Brazil |
| 2020s | 20.41 billion current USD | 65.33 billion current USD | 44.92 billion current USD |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
